Extraction protocol |
Total RNA was isolated from tissue using TRI reagent based method. Total RNA (500 ng) was processed for preparing whole transcriptome sequencing library. Enrichment of whole transcriptome RNA by depleting ribosomal RNA ( rRNA ) was processed for preparing whole transcriptome sequencing library using MGIEasy RNA Directional Library Prep Kit (MGI) according to manufacturer’s instruction.

Data processing |
Reference genome sequence data from Homo sapiens were obtained from the NCBI Genome database (assembly ID: GRCh38). The reference genome indexing and read mapping of tissue samples were performed using STAR software (ver. 2.5.4b). Then, the read counts per million fragments mapped (CPM) of each sample were estimated and were log2-transformed. Assembly: GRCh38 Supplementary files format and content: tab-delimited text format with log2 transformed CPM values of transcripts
